Das Ergebnis ist dabei von der Präzision abhängig, mit der die oben erwähnten Verfahrensschritte durchgeführt werden können.A flat connector comb is made according to a conventional method manufactured in which its components in an injection mold be inserted where they are then encapsulated then form a coherent structure. At This method has the disadvantage that on the one hand the insertion of the components is a process step that requires a lot of care requires folding and precise alignment of the parts at the. In addition, the components may be egg must be electrically connected to each other sen, for example via a solder connection. These circumstances make the manufacturing process more complicated and therefore long more difficult and more expensive. The result is precision depending on the process steps mentioned above can be carried out.

Fig. 1 shows a four-way pre-molded part which has been punched out of a metal strip and separated. In this form, the pre-molded part is placed in the injection mold. Beforehand, bending operations are carried out at certain circuit flags 2 , as can be seen from FIG. 2.
Dann erfolgt die Umspritzung des Bereichs 3 zwischen den Steckerstiften 5 und den Anschlußenden 2 mit Kunststoff 4, so daß nun alle Kammteile stabil relativ zueinander fixiert sind.Then the area 3 is overmolded between the connector pins 5 and the connection ends 2 with plastic 4 , so that all of the comb parts are now fixed relative to one another.

FIGS. 3A and 3B show the middle region 3 of the flat connector comb which is overmolded with plastic. Fig. 3B also shows that in the plastic-molded part 4 from a circuit flag on a tongue was punched out and offset parallel to the other connecting lugs. This tongue 8 has a stripping terminal lug at its end. This lead-out of the tongue 8 in a second plane parallel to the plane of the other flat plugs is a very space-saving design.
In einem letzten Schritt werden nach dem Umspritzen des mittleren Bereichs des Flachsteckerkamms Verbindungsstege 6 weggestanzt, die die Flachstecker untereinander verbunden und lagefixiert haben.In a last step, after the overmolding of the central region of the flat connector comb, connecting webs 6 are punched out, which have connected the flat connectors to one another and fixed them in position.
Anschlußenden und Steckerenden werden vor dem Biegen mit einer die Leitfähigkeit verbessernden Metallschicht, z. B. Gold, beschichtet. Das Grundmaterial des Flachsteckerkamms ist beispielsweise eine CaSn6F41-Legierung.The ends of the connectors and the ends of the connectors are coated with a metal layer that improves conductivity, e.g. B. gold coated. The base material of the flat connector comb is, for example, a CaSn 6 F 41 alloy.
Das Auskühlen des plastikumspritzten Mittelteils des Flach steckerkamms wird dadurch beschleunigt, daß dort, wo es die Konfiguration der Leiterbahn zuläßt, mehr oder weniger große durchgehende Fenster im Kunststoff vorgesehen sind, um die auszukühlende Masse zu verringern.The cooling of the plastic-molded middle part of the flat stepping comb is accelerated by the fact that where it is the Configuration of the trace allows more or less large through-going windows are provided in the plastic to the reduce the mass to be cooled.
Das vorstehend beschriebene Verfahren bewirkt eine Einspa rung von Verfahrensschritten bei der Herstellung eines Flachsteckerkamms und erhöht darüber hinaus die Präzision der Zuordnung der einzelnen Kammelemente zueinander.The method described above saves tion of process steps in the manufacture of a Flat connector comb and also increases precision the assignment of the individual comb elements to each other.

- a group of interconnected flat plug combs ( 1 ) are punched out of a metal strip,
- - Connection ends ( 2 ) or connection areas ( 2 ) are bent according to a desired configuration,
- - The area ( 3 ) between the plug pins ( 5 ) and the connection ends ( 2 ) is extrusion-coated with plastic ( 4 ), so that there all comb parts are stably fixed against each other, and
- - Connecting webs ( 6 ) between plug comb parts, which only serve to fix the comb parts before the extrusion coating, are punched out.
